2012-03-04 2 views
1

作成しません:openFileOutputは、私は、ファイルを作成するには、次のコードを使用したファイル

 FileOutputStream fos = app.openFileOutput(fileName, Context.MODE_WORLD_WRITEABLE); 
     fos.write(content.getBytes()); 
     fos.close(); 

ファイルを(サムスンギャラクシータブ2.3のSDK)エミュレータ上で作成するが、それは私のデバイス上に作成されていません。

例外もログもありません。

私がgetFilesDirを使用する場合、私はdoeが存在しないパスを取得します。 /data/data/it.xyz.xyz/files。

+0

許可セット? – WarrenFaith

答えて

0

間違いなく動作するはずです。ファイルが実際に存在するかどうかを確認していますか?私が意味することは:あなたが例えば、ファイルマネージャーでは/ data/..フォルダーにアクセスすることはできませんが、自分のアプリケーションからそのファイルにアクセスできます。

関連する問題